Historical/Biographical Note

Daniel Nilva was a freelance photographer involved in the Film and Photo League in the 1920s. Nilva also worked as a staff photographer for the International Ladies' Garment Workers Union for many years and saw himself as an historian of the role of the Communist Party in the labor movement.

Scope and Contents

This small collection contains various newsletters, publications, and mailings by the Communist Party, the Socialist Party, the Young Communist League and Communist Party opposition groups on the Left. There is also a small amount of biographical material on Nilva.
